This Quick Alfredo Sauce (with cream cheese) is my go-to Alfredo sauce recipe now. I did not realize how life changing it is to ditch heavy cream and use cream cheese in Alfredo sauce instead! It is brilliant. I don’t always have heavy cream on hand, but I usually do have cream cheese, making this recipe so easy to throw together anytime! It is lighter and much easier to make than traditional Alfredo sauce but still tastes incredible. So creamy and delicious and no one would ever guess how easy and quick it is to make! This is a perfect recipe for busy weeknight dinners when you have a hungry family to feed but your are short on time. My boys absolutely LOVE Chicken Alfredo and are so happy when I serve this for dinner.

I like to pour this sauce over pasta with grilled chicken or sautéed shrimp and add broccoli on top or on the side. A stellar dinner that your family will love and you can have on the table in less than 30 minutes! Yay!!

Description

Perfectly creamy and flavorful Alfredo sauce that comes together quickly with simple ingredients. Perfect for a busy weeknight dinner.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 Tablespoons Butter
  • 3 cloves Garlic, finely minced
  • 4 oz Cream Cheese, softened and cut into 1/2-inch cubes
  • 1 cup Milk
  • 1 1/2 cups Parmesan Cheese, freshly grated
  • ½ teaspoons Ground Black P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on Kosher Salt, or to taste

 


Instructions

  1. Melt butter in a medium, nonstick saucepan over medium heat.
  2. Add minced garlic and cook for 2 minutes.
  3. Add cream cheese, stirring with a whisk until smooth.
  4. Add milk, a little at a time, whisking until smooth.
  5. Stir in grated parmesan cheese and pepper.
  6. Season with kosher salt, if needed.
  7. Remove from heat when sauce reaches desired consistency. Sauce will thicken quickly.
  8. Enjoy!
